New Mexico Pueblos Want In On Fed Mineral Lease Ban Suit
Two Native American pueblos have asked a New Mexico federal judge to let them intervene in a Navajo Nation suit seeking to undo a Biden administration order withdrawing federal land from new mineral leasing around Chaco Canyon, saying it is sacred to all pueblo people.

Navajo Nation Looks To Block Federal Mineral Leasing Ban
The Navajo Nation has sued the U.S. Department of the Interior in a bid to block a Biden administration order withdrawing federal land from new mineral leasing and development near a national park in New Mexico, saying the ban would cause tribal allottees to suffer financial hardships.
